The DJC collects and prepares data on various credit related records. You can search the individual databases below or use our Names Search feature to search them all simultaneously.

Current databases include:

Bankruptcies

Bankruptcy notices filed in Western Washington, Eastern Washington, Oregon and Alaska U.S. Bankruptcy Court for businesses and individuals located in their respective state. The database includes Chapter 7, 11 and 13 filings and lists the filer's name, and address.

Liens

Workman's liens filed against companies in King, Pierce and Snohomish Counties. Generally a lien is filed when one company doesn't receive promised payment for goods and services provided to another company. This is a great place to check the reliability of a firm you may (or may not) want to do business with.

Federal Tax Liens

Federal Tax Liens filed by the IRS against companies or individuals in King, Pierce and Snohomish Counties who are negligent in their tax payments. The database includes information on the name of whom the lien is filed against, the lien amount and the type of tax filing that's involved.
